There
is an Algorithm, which can achieve incredibly
fast pattern recognition. It does not grow
exponentially for any size of database. In fact,
it exists within the database. That is the
Intuitive Algorithm.
|
| |
|
The
Algorithm begins with a coded link between
symptoms and diseases. It can be "Yes",
"No" or, "Uncertain." This
code is contained within the database. Answers to
questions lead to a process of elimination.
|

|
| |
|

|
When
the answer is "Yes", all diseases coded
"No" are eliminated in a single pass.
If pain is present, all diseases, which clearly
lack pain are eliminated. The unique feature of
the search process is that it does not select. It
eliminates.
|
| |
|
If,
instead of "Yes", the answer is
"No", all diseases, coded
"Yes" for the question, are eliminated.
If the patient has no pain, all diseases which
always exhibit painful symptoms are eliminated.
Any disease, which occasionally exhibits pain is
retained for both "Yes" and for
"No" answers.
|

|
| |
|

|
A
sequence of questions carries this process of
elimination rapidly to leave one disease, or a
probable group of diseases. Specific questions
will then identify the disease. If all diseases
are eliminated, the conclusion is that the
disease is unknown to the Expert System.
|
| |
|
The
Questioning priority is decided, by choosing the
one with the most number of "Yes" links
to diseases. Questions only related to deleted
diseases are removed. Since the whole database,
including questions, is evaluated, the process is
holistic. Since the links reside within the
database, its size is unlimited.

The
"Yes/No" links resemble the rules of
rule based Expert Systems. Tens of thousands of
rules are evaluated by the system. But, the rule
based AI Systems cannot handle uncertainty.
Whereas this process manages suspicion by
retaining uncertain diseases for further query.
By eliminating irrelevant questions, it avoids
Stupidity.
|
| |
|
The
Expert System has delivered solutions in the
diagnosis of diseases. Doctors have verified its
competence. It was tested in software areas, in
company knowledge bases and for Constitutional
Law. It was certified for machine diagnostics for
ABB, the electrical giant.
|

|
| |
|

|
After
responses to a sequence of questions, the
Algorithm delivers its solution. That can take
time. But, many questions can be answered in a
single pass. These can be the many results of a
lab report, or, the multiple online parameters of
a power plant. An adequate number of simultaneous
answers can deliver immediate recognition. That
is instant, real time pattern recognition.

Elimination
is switching off - inhibition. Nerve cells
extensively inhibit the activities of other
cells. Many neurons highlight their perceptions
through the inhibition of surrounding nerve
cells. Inhibition is a well documented process in
the nervous system. Inhibition works to identify
context.
|

|
| |
|

|
The
symptoms of a disease form the context for its
identification. The Intuitive Algorithm draws a
swift conclusion from a context through
elimination. People draw conclusions from all the
contexts around us. A doctor eliminates a wide
range of illnesses, if a patient can just walk
into the surgery. Elimination is a potent search
weapon to identify context.
|
| |
|
Let
us assume that nerve cells identify context
through pattern recognition. We can then begin to
understand the whole as a powerful linked system.
The pattern of flow of impulses in the system has
been extensively charted by science. It is a
process that takes but 20 milliseconds from input
to output. Just half a second between the shadow
and the scream.
